About the book 
She trusts animals more than men. He runs through women like tires. Will an orphaned child force them to change gears? 

With her sister’s death, Nora’s life changed in an instant. Forced to raise her orphaned nephew, the animal rescuer doesn’t expect to be dumped and fired by her kid-hating boyfriend/boss. After her own close call and a message from beyond, Nora introduces the little boy to his handsome, fast-living absentee father. 

Davey Johnson is a hot-shot NASCAR driver who never wanted to be slowed down by fatherhood. But when he finds out he has a nine-year-old son, he vows to be a better father than his old man. When his first efforts fail in a big way, he enlists Nora’s parenting help. But what starts as a chore transforms into something way hotter than a final lap. 

When Davey’s sponsors clash with Nora’s vegan ways, he’s forced to choose between his passion for racing and his love of Nora. Will they be able to blend their lives or will their romance run right off the track?

I couldn't put this one down.  I enjoyed Nora's Promise way more than I expected.  It did exceed my expectations. 

This was just a good love story.  I won't give anything away but it does end with a Happily Ever After.  And also with an excerpt for the next one in the series which is already on my TBR list.

All the characters are fun and charming.  I enjoyed them all.  
Nora's Promise isn't just about Nora and Davey's romance but his mom and his pseudo dad/friend business partner find their way back to each other after years of seperation.  It's another sweet romance all in one book. 

Sedona Hutton did an excellent job of giving this reader a story that I actually didn't want to end. But I was glad and enjoyed how it all came together and worked out in the end.  

Nora's Promise is one that you don't want to miss.  There are a few bedroom scenes and MaMa might blush abit but my Jazzy Grandma would be turning the pages!  I did.  

If you enjoy a good sweet romance with a smidgeon of sizzle check this one out.  And put the next one on you TBR pile.  I can't wait to read it!

  3. My question for the author is where do you get your ideas for your stories.

    ReplyDelete
    Replies
    1. Hi Darlene - That's a great question! The honest answer is EVERYWHERE! I can't seem to turn off my writers curiosity...so everywhere I go I listen to conversations, everything I read makes me wonder, "if I twisted this aspect and turned x into y, would it make an amazing story?" For Nora's Promise, a sweet cow named Dudley who lived at The Gentle Barn Tennessee inspired me to create Nora's character. There's a great video about Dudley on The Gentle Barn's website if you're interested. Last, but not least, my husband is a rock star! I'm always asking him questions(especially when we're on road trips and I have his undivided attention!) I'll throw out character ideas and pick his brain for twists I may not have considered. I tend to spend a lot of time developing my characters before writing so his ideas are invaluable. Thanks for the great question!
